Kitchen Cleaning
The kitchen isn’t just where mom’s legendary lasagna comes alive; it’s also the epicenter of grease and crumb and deserves some extra love:
- Scrub-a-dub those countertops, sinks, and faucets till they’re squeaky clean.
- Get those cabinets and drawers looking fresh from both the inside and out.
- Appliances like the oven, microwave, and fridge need to be freed from layers of gunk.
- Floors need a good sweep and mop, so they’re not sticky from the last spaghetti night.
Task | Cleaned Goodies |
---|---|
Surface Spruce-up | Countertops, sinks, faucets |
Cabinet Cleanup | Inside & outside of every nook and cranny |
Appliance Scrubbing | Ovens, microwaves, refrigerators |
Floor Sweep & Shine | Sweeping and mopping |

Cost Considerations
Budgeting for Professional Cleaning
If you’re a landlord aiming to keep your property spick-and-span and in line with those rental agreements, then budgeting for professional cleaning after a tenant moves out is your road to glory. These cleaning wizards offer a smorgasbord of options and prices that fluctuate based on your property size and the nitty-gritty of what needs a scrub.
When setting your budget, keep these tidbits in mind:
- Property Size: Bigger digs mean you’re gonna be shelling out more.
- Scope of Cleaning: Whether it’s just a once-over, a thorough scour, or a particular focus like the grease-laden kitchen or grimy bathroom.
- Frequency: Are you calling in the cavalry for routine touch-ups or just once for a deep blast?
- Extra Services: Sprucing up carpets, polishing windows, or going green-clean might add a little extra to the bill.
Property Size | Standard Cleaning Cost (€) | Deep Cleaning Cost (€) |
---|---|---|
1-Bedroom Apartment | 100 | 150 |
2-Bedroom House | 150 | 250 |
3-Bedroom House | 200 | 300 |
4-Bedroom House | 250 | 400 |
